Summary
Vinicius Junior, a key Real Madrid player, is in strong form this season, but his future at the club is uncertain due to stalled contract talks. Despite his successful partnership with teammate Kylian Mbappe, changes in team leadership and tactics under coach Xabi Alonso have raised questions about his long-term role with Real Madrid.
Key Facts
- Vinicius Junior has scored five goals and made four assists this season.
- He played a crucial role in a recent 3-1 victory against Villarreal with two goals and several key plays.
- Vinicius' contract with Real Madrid is due to expire in 2027, but renewal talks have stalled.
- The arrival of coach Xabi Alonso has led to tactical changes, affecting Vinicius' guaranteed starter status.
- Vinicius is considering his future role in the team, given teammate Kylian Mbappe's leadership.
- Real Madrid may consider other options if Vinicius does not renew his contract by the summer.
- Vinicius has faced hostility, including racist incidents which have gone to court.
